Plumbers and Heating Technicians in Cheltenham, Gloucestershire,
Plumbers and Heating Technicians
1 Union Street,
Cheltenham, Gloucestershire ,
GL54 1BU
UNITED KINGDOM
Worldwide > United Kingdom > Cheltenham, Gloucestershire > Plumbers and Heating Technicians